Add thelocalreport.in As A Trusted Source For free real-time breaking news alerts delivered straight to…
Tag: Greece
Uk
Continue Reading
Aid workers face jail terms for ‘migrant smuggling’ in Greece
Add thelocalreport.in As A Trusted Source On the Ground Newsletter: Receive weekly dispatches from our…